Blutige Anfänger
Practical semester at the Halle/Saale Police College: Finally out of the seminar rooms and into real life - which for the students means: real murder cases. With the support of their trainers in the homicide squad, they will have to solve this. The beginners sometimes overshoot the mark, make mistakes and have to learn new things on their way to becoming fully qualified detectives. In each episode, a case between the university and real life is dissected, discussed and solved, while the private complications of the students, lecturers and trainers are not neglected.

Polizeiruf 110
Polizeiruf 110 is a long-running German language detective television series. The first episode was broadcast 27 June 1971 in the German Democratic Republic, and after the dissolution of Fernsehen der DDR the series was picked up by ARD. It was originally created as a counterpart to the West German series Tatort, and quickly became a public favorite.
